物联网与软件开发:实现智能化和自动化的未来
物联网
物联网(Internet of Things,简称IoT)是指通过各种传感器、设备和互联网连接,将物理世界与数字世界相连接的网络系统,物联网技术的发展使得各种设备和物体能够相互通信、交互,并实现智能化和自动化的功能。
物联网的关键在于设备之间的互联互通,它通过传感器和嵌入式系统收集各种数据,并将这些数据通过互联网传输到云端,然后进行分析和处理,通过物联网,我们可以实现对设备的远程监控和控制,以及实时数据的收集和分析。
软件开发
软件开发是指将计算机程序设计的概念转化为实际的软件产品的过程,在物联网领域,软件开发起着至关重要的作用,它涉及到设计、编码、测试和维护软件应用程序的各个方面。
在物联网中,软件开发需要解决多样化的问题,开发人员需要设计和开发适用于物联网环境的应用程序,这些应用程序需要能够与各种设备和传感器进行交互,并处理大量的实时数据,软件开发还需要考虑安全性和隐私保护的问题,由于物联网涉及到大量的数据传输和设备连接,安全性成为了一个重要的挑战。
物联网与软件开发的关系
物联网和软件开发是相互依存的,物联网需要软件开发来实现其各种功能和应用,而软件开发则需要物联网提供的数据和设备连接来进行开发和测试。
物联网的发展带来了软件开发的新挑战和机遇,在物联网环境下,软件开发需要考虑到大规模设备的连接和数据处理,以及安全性和隐私保护等问题,物联网也为软件开发提供了更多的数据和设备接口,使得开发人员可以开发出更加智能化和自动化的应用程序。
物联网与软件开发的未来
物联网和软件开发的未来将更加紧密地结合在一起,随着物联网技术的不断发展和应用场景的扩大,软件开发将成为物联网领域的核心技术之一。
物联网将进一步智能化和自动化,通过物联网和软件开发的结合,我们可以实现更加智能的家居设备、城市管理系统、工业自动化等,智能家居可以通过物联网连接各种设备和传感器,实现远程控制和智能化的功能,城市管理系统可以通过物联网收集和分析各种数据,实现智能交通、环境监测等功能,工业自动化可以通过物联网实现设备的远程监控和自动化控制,提高生产效率和质量。
物联网和软件开发的结合将推动智能化和自动化的未来,通过不断的创新和应用,我们可以利用物联网和软件开发技术来改善生活和工作环境,实现更加智能和高效的社会发展。
还没有评论,来说两句吧...